So let’s know the history of ‘World Milk Day’ and its importance: World Milk Day is celebrated every year on June 1 with the aim of recognizing the dairy industry and spreading awareness among people about the benefits of milk. Celebrating this day began in the year 2001, when the United Nations Food and Agriculture Organization established World Milk Day. At present, this day is celebrated in many countries around the world. While World Milk Day is celebrated on 1st June all over the world, National Milk Day is celebrated every year on 26th November in India. In India, this day is celebrated on the occasion of the birthday of Dr. Verghese Kurien, who is also known as the father of White Revolution in India. He is also known as ‘Milk Man’. The goal of celebrating Milk Day was to educate people about its benefits and importance, as well as how milk benefits local economies and communities. This day is celebrated every year only to increase public awareness about it. According to FAO, about six billion people consume dairy products. Not only this, dairy business helps in running the livelihood of more than one billion people.
